Chicken stuffed w/ spinach & tomato


can you tell I went to costco & have lots of tomato & spinach to use up?


Cast of characters: boneless skinless chicken breast, baby spinach, cherry tomato, salsa, garlic red wine vinegar, S&P I thawed a cheap ole bagged boneless skinless chicken; (I like the cheap kind, cause they are small prob 4oz. because they have lots of fat, but that is easily trimmed away & worth the price to me) I sliced in half from right to left, but not all the way through & season with salt & pepper


For the stuffing I used, baby spinach that chopped into small pieces. I also sliced a handful of cherry tomatoes, a splash or 2 of red wine vinegar, a sprinkle of garlic powder, salt & pepper stir and let marinade. place "stuffing" into the pocket of the chicken, secure with a wooden skewer and place into a greased baking dish. I topped the stuffed chicken with a little salsa and cooked in a 350 oven for about 25-30 mins or until cooked through depending on the size of chicken breast. It was a beautiful presentation! Would have been even better with some bacon & cheese stuffed inside! I served mine with some rotel rice. Actually could be stuff with tons of different options!
